Abstract

Objective: To observe the distribution of kidney- deficiency syndrome types of patients with dysmenorrheal due to adenomyosis. Methods: 92 patients with adenomyosis were chosen into the case group,and 85 patients with no adenomyosis who came to hospital for test at the same period were chosen into the control group. The patients in the two groups took part in questionnaire survey. Results: As a single- syndrome type,kidney- yang deficiency and blood stasis appear most often in the case group. While as a compound- syndrome type,qi- stagnation- blood stasis due to kidney deficiency and qi- stagnation due to kidney deficiency had a higher ratio. The patient's body constitution of qi- stagnation- blood stasis due to kidney deficiency,qi- stagnation due to kidney deficiency,and cold qi stagnation due to kidney- yang deficiency mainly belongs to blood stasis constitution,qi stagnation constitution and qi deficiency constitution. Conclusion: Qi- stagnation- blood stasis due to kidney deficiency and qi- stagnation due to kidney deficiency are the major kidney- deficiency syndrome types,and blood stasis constitution is the most susceptible.
